The only fish I kept by name was Tinman , a Giant silver Clown Knife
Chitala (Notopterus) chitala.After 8 or 10 years or so I traded him in a few months ago for more Clown Loach habitat losing a 10 pound fishes bioload opened up some space and I had also added 50 Syncrossus helodes I need to feed a lot which means lots of waste. My three largest Chromobotia macracanthus are differentiated as Left Spot,Right Spot and No Spot because of markings so those might be almost names.I have a Rapheal over 15 years old with no name..... :oops:
